Our contract gives us protection to a certain point when it comes to the first accident.
Provided, you report the accident. Below is the Master language on discharge for an accident and using the drivers previous record of accidents. (Article 7; Section 6.).

And, here is the Southern Region Supplemental language on discharge. Other Supplements may read a little different, but will most likely be similar. So, in short, in most cases involving a chargeable accident, you are protected by contract so long as you report it. Unless you are a habitual offender.
